#7a4eb5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7a4eb5 is composed of 47.8% red, 30.6%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.6% cyan, 56.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 265.6 degrees, a saturation of 41% and a lightness of 50.8%. #7a4eb5 color hex could be obtained by blending #f49cff with #00006b.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#7a4eb5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7a4eb5 has RGB values of R:122, G:78,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 8015541.

Shades and Tints of #7a4eb5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020103 is the darkest color, while #f7f4f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#7a4eb5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817e85 is the less saturated color, while #700af9 is the most saturated one.
